
On Christmas Eve last year, the Russian Icebreaker M.V. Akademik Shokalskiy got trapped in tightly packed ice in the Antarctic waters—along with 73 other passengers, adventure travel photographer Andrew Peacock waited to be evacuated by helicopter.
With nowhere to go, Peacock took the opportunity to document this unusual experience—the awe-inspiring Antarctic landscape might have prompted him to pick up his camera as well.
From massive and beautiful icebergs to sweet penguins who practically posed for pictures, the photographer has certainly made good use of his time on the trapped icebreaker.
